Paper Engineering & Pop-Ups For Dummies by Ruth Toor is a practical guide and instructional book that introduces readers to the art of creating intricate paper pop-up designs and paper engineering projects. It covers foundational techniques, step-by-step tutorials, and tips for crafting three-dimensional paper models, making it suitable for both beginners and hobbyists interested in paper craft arts.
